Q: Is 3,869,832 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,869,832 is a composite number.

Why is 3,869,832 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,869,832 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 24 383 421 766 842 1,149 1,263 1,532 1,684 2,298 2,526 3,064 3,368 4,596 5,052 9,192 10,104 161,243 322,486 483,729 644,972 967,458 1,289,944 1,934,916 and 3,869,832, with no remainder.

Since 3,869,832 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,869,832, it is a composite number.
